Located in North West London, Brondesbury Train Station serves as a crucial link within the London's extensive rail network. Whether you're a local commuter or a visitor ready to explore the bustling city, this station offers the convenience and essential services to ensure a smooth journey. Positioned on the North London Line, Brondesbury is well-connected to numerous popular destinations and diverse neighborhoods, making it a prime starting point for your London experience.
At Brondesbury Station, ticket purchasing is a breeze with easily accessible ticket machines, open from 07:30 to 10:10, Monday through Friday. Planning to collect tickets you’ve ordered online? You can do so at these machines, which are suitably accessible for all passengers, thanks to excellent induction loop systems in place.
Although the station is equipped with CCTV to maintain security, it should be noted that it lacks certain amenities such as step-free access to platforms and public restrooms. However, there is a seating area available for your comfort, and waiting rooms open at various hours throughout the week.
For onward journeys, there are plenty of options to suit your needs. The station is buzzing with activity, offering easy access to local bus services. With stops conveniently located on Kilburn High Road, eastbound travelers can head towards Camden Road or Stratford, while westbound services take you towards Richmond.
If you are more inclined to use the London Underground, Kilburn Underground Station is merely 150 meters away. Furthermore, connections to key airports such as Gatwick and Luton are possible via rail connections with First Capital Connect at West Hampstead.

Located in the suburban area of Bromley in South East London, Sundridge Park train station is a convenient hub for local commuters and travelers alike. This charming station connects travelers to an extensive rail network and provides several amenities to ensure a smooth journey. Whether you're daily commuting or setting out on an adventure, Sundridge Park offers a gateway to numerous destinations.
At Sundridge Park, your ticket purchasing and collection are made easy with a ticket office open from 06:10 to 10:40 on weekdays. If you prefer autonomous options or arrive outside these hours, fret not, as ticket machines are readily available. Accessible ticket machines are conveniently positioned at the station forecourt, ensuring all passengers have straightforward access. Furthermore, smartcard users can benefit from the station's smartcard issuance and validation services. To enhance your journey, induction loops are installed for those with hearing impairments.
Customer assistance is readily available at Sundridge Park with a help point that provides access to train departure screens and announcements. While the station might not have staff present round the clock, assistance for the navigation and boarding is offered during staffing hours from 06:00 to 11:00, Monday to Friday. Although step-free access is limited to certain areas, arrangements can be made in advance for additional aid. For security and peace of mind, the station is equipped with CCTV surveillance.
Sundridge Park is not just a stop but a springboard to further destinations. A variety of transport links such as bus routes are available to extend your journey seamlessly. Rail replacement services and local buses like the 126 and 261 allow continued travel even during disruptions or planned engineering works.
